Q.

(i) Cork cambium is an example of lateral meristem.

(ii) In the young dicot stem, cambium is present in patches as a single layer between xylem and phloem..

(iii) Interfasciucular cambium and intrafacicular cambium combinedly form cambial ring

Among the above statements, which are correct?

Detailed Solution

Cork cambium and Vascular cambium are lateral meristems. Vascular cambium of dicot stem is formed by both fascicular cambium and interfascicular cambium. In young dicot stem, each vascular bundle has a single layered strip of fascicular cambium between xylem and phloem.
